titleOfInvention |
Improving the grinding to size and stamping behavior of hydrophobic coated spectacle lenses |
abstract |
The invention relates to an ophthalmic glass that has a special layer structure and a surface energy of less than 15 mJ/m2. The invention also relates to the use thereof during grinding to size and/or stamping of spectacle lenses. |
